Analysis

In 2023, secondary education, pupils in Cameroon stood at 2.01 million.

Compared with earlier readings it is up 1.2% on the previous year and up 10.7% over ten years.

Over the whole period, secondary education, pupils in Cameroon peaked at 2.21 million in 2016 and was at its lowest, 76,461, in 1971.

That places Cameroon 52nd out of 206 countries with data for 2023, putting it in the top quarter.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

Averages by decade

DecadeAverage LowestHighest Years
1970s 132,314 76,461 198,616 9
1980s 318,107 212,860 439,365 10
1990s 546,622 457,161 642,781 8
2000s 873,830 698,444 1.27 million 10
2010s 1.90 million 1.57 million 2.21 million 6
2020s 1.97 million 1.92 million 2.01 million 3
